7 Homes, Hog Farm Destroyed in Colorado Tornadoes

EADS, Colo. (AP) - At least seven homes and a hog farm were destroyed after rare nighttime tornadoes reportedly ripped through sparsely populated counties on the southeastern Colorado plains.

Authorities say tornadoes were reported early Friday in Prowers, Kiowa and Bent counties, where the homes were destroyed.

State emergency management division spokeswoman Micki Trost says a hog farm in Prowers County was also destroyed.

The National Weather Service hasn't confirmed the touchdowns yet but a team is assessing the damage.

Overnight tornadoes are rare in Colorado, where cooler nighttime temperatures usually don't create severe weather.
